Participate effectively: Amit Shah to new Lok Sabha MPs
Shah said each Lok Sabha MP represents more than 15 lakh people and thus has a great responsibility in fulfilling their aspirations.

Shah suggested that new MPs could set aside all party-related differences and contribute to debates and lawmaking through a thorough understanding of the functioning of the House.
The suggestions have come at a time when the Lok Sabha is becoming an arena for shouting slogans and counter-slogans, with some BJP members using majority to pressure the opposition speakers during debates.
Shah advised MPs to spend more time in Parliament library and learn about rules, traditions and procedures. He said a good parliamentarian is one who is happy and inquisitive. He said there are three ways of becoming an effective parliamentarian — be active in the House, create an impression in your constituency through your work in the Lok Sabha and increase your influence by enhancing the reputation of Parliament.
